IF I was gonna break my no-new-mods vow, I'd probably start with one of these. Would look great with a set of squids or the M4 (haven't decided which I like best yet).



That one's from GSG at $160 in fiberglass or $220 in CF.

There's also an ABS one from Metisse at $180.

Both from Wild Hair Accessories

Or I could try to make my own out of sheet metal or glass.

Has anyone here tackled this on a 1050 yet?
